Frequently Asked Questions about Woodworking Projects for Beginners

  • What tools do I need to start a project?

    Basic tools for beginners include a saw, hammer, screwdriver, measuring tape, and sandpaper. Specific projects may require additional tools, which are listed in the project details.

  • How do I select the right type of wood for my project?

    Choose wood based on durability, appearance, and cost. Pine is affordable and good for beginners, while hardwoods like oak offer more durability for furniture projects.

  • Can I customize the designs provided?

    Yes, while starting with a basic design, you can customize dimensions and finishes to suit your personal preferences or space requirements.

  • What safety measures should I follow?

    Always wear safety goggles, use ear protection when operating loud tools, and work in a well-ventilated area. Read all safety instructions associated with each tool and material.

  • How can I improve my woodworking skills?

    Practice regularly, start with simple projects to build your confidence and skills, and gradually tackle more complex tasks. Watching tutorial videos and reading woodworking guides can also help.
